PRE-VINTAGE
RAINFALL: Average winter rainfall | Dry conditions from spring through to summer
TEMPERATURE: High winds at flowering | Hot late spring and early summer leading to average summer temperatures
UPSHOT: Inconsistent flowering and fruit set | Low crops
VINTAGE
RAINFALL: Early February rain event | Dry otherwise
TEMPERAURE: Warm days and cool nights
UPSHOT: Consistent ripening conditions | Perfect extended flavour development | High natural acid | Intense flavours and vibrancy of fruit
C-BLOCK: Very shallow red clay loam overlying shattered limestone | North-south oriented rows | Elevated eastern aspect
UPSHOT: Reduced natural vine vigour | Intense and vibrant flavour profile
FERMENTATION: De-stemmed | Pressed to stainless steel tanks| Juice oxidatively handled | 12-hour cold settling before racking to oak | Cool fermentation (12-18°C)
OAK: French – 2nd and 3rd use | 7 months maturation on lees
TECH ANALYSIS: Alcohol – 13.5% | pH – 3.21 | Acid – 7.2g/L | RS – 1.8g/L
Delicate florals of cherry blossom and vanilla, with hints of ginger and nutmeg add subtle spice. White peach flows across the palate, bringing a sense of freshness, while graphite lends quiet depth. Refined and textural.
